The desire for risk and reward can be traced back to ancient times, where the earliest forms of gambling emerged in various forms, such as dice games, betting on events, and games of chance. One significant area where gambling found early traction was in ancient China, where the first recorded evidence of a gambling game dates back to around 2300 BC. In ancient Rome, gambling was often linked to political and social events, with emperors themselves participating in games of chance.
The evolution of gambling in the Western world saw significant developments in the Middle Ages. During this time, gambling practices began to blend with entertainment. Betting on gladiator fights, jousting tournaments, and other forms of public spectacles became increasingly popular. However, gambling was often met with controversy, as various religious and political leaders condemned it. In response, many communities imposed strict regulations to limit the influence of gambling on society.

Gambling continued to evolve throughout the 19th and 20th centuries with the establishment of legal casinos and lotteries in many countries. Las Vegas, Nevada, became synonymous with gambling during the 20th century, and its rise coincided with the expansion of legal casino operations across the United States. This period also marked the growth of commercialized sports betting, and gambling went from being a vice or illicit activity to a regulated and legitimate form of entertainment.
With the advent of online gambling, particularly in the late 1990s, the industry experienced another massive shift. Online casinos and sports betting websites exploded in popularity, providing players with the ability to place bets or play casino games from the comfort of their homes. The rise of mobile gambling further accelerated this trend, making gambling more accessible than ever before.
